Earlier on Twitter, singer Tems responded to trolls who expect her to be a “Christian savior” in her music. In the tweet, the “Free Mind” artist added that she’s not trying to uphold anyone’s beliefs about religion and doesn’t want to be put into a box with the type of music she puts out.

Tems has done musical collaborations with the likes of chart-topping artists such as Future, Drake, Wizkid, Justin Bieber, and more.

“I’m Trying To Impress Myself, Not You”

The “No Woman, No Cry” singer also implied that she doesn’t boast about the type of artist she is to prove anything to anyone as she continues her singing career.

“I don’t brag because I’m not playing the same game. I don’t need to brag, I am who I am whether you know it or not.

It is the house that is built on the solid rock that will withstand the storm. 

I’m trying to impress myself not you.”

The “Higher” artist ended the tweet storm by using a gif of actor Denzel Washington shutting the door in someone’s face, saying she doesn’t care if anyone approves of her words. 

Still, Tems intends to continue to make music for a loyal fanbase who have been with her since she came into the music game in 2018 and said she still has much room to improve.
